Covers Timber and Builders Merchant has acquired Wingham Timber and Mouldings, based near Canterbury in Kent. Wingham Timber is an independent timber merchant supplying construction grade timber, sheet materials, internal mouldings, wooden flooring, garden fencing and decking materials, along with timber for garden structures. It has a range of fencing manufacturing machinery, as well as moulders and a treatment plant.


Wingham Timber’s principal owners and directors, Beau Hart and Nigel Hylands, will continue their involvement with the business, with Hart assisting during a transitional period, and Hylands continuing to operate the business.

RGB opens new branch in Truro the South West.


The new Truro site will be supplying a wide range of building materials, landscaping goods, decorating products, and plumbing and heating supplies. The opening of the branch has brought 11 new jobs to the area.


RGB Building Supplies has opened a new branch on Threemilestone Industrial Estate in Truro.


RGB has been operating across Devon, Cornwall and Somerset for over 170 years and has grown to become one of the leading builders merchants in
